The Rose and Crown hosts lots of fundraising events throughout the year, raising thousands of pounds for local groups and charities. In 2007, events held at the pub raised a massive £12,789! The main fundraiser is the weekly pub quiz which raised a total of £8662.50. There's a wide range of groups that benefit from the pub's quiz, ranging from local groups like the scouts, church, chapel, football clubs and WI to charities such as the MS Society, LIVES and the air ambulance.
Not only does the quiz raise a huge amount of money for good causes, but it’s also a great social event too – all done with lots of good humour and never taken too seriously (well not usually).
The quiz is held every Thursday night starting around 9pm and everyone is welcome.
